Wing Lei – Wynn Las Vegas

Wing Lei, awarded a Michelin star, offers a fusion of Cantonese, Shanghai, and Szechuan flavors, presented with a Western flair. Nestled within the luxurious Wynn Las Vegas, it boasts an opulent setting and exquisite dishes like the Imperial Peking Duck, which is a must-try. Their tasting menus provide a lavish journey through traditional Chinese flavors, redefined with elegance and precision.

Ping Pang Pong – Gold Coast Hotel & Casino

A local favorite, Ping Pang Pong at the Gold Coast Hotel & Casino, is known for its authentic Chinese flavors. This bustling spot serves up dim sum during the day and traditional specialties from different Chinese regions by night. Their expansive menu includes delights like live seafood, roasted duck, and handcrafted dim sum, offering a truly genuine experience reminiscent of a busy Hong Kong eatery.

Red 8 – Wynn Las Vegas

Red 8 at Wynn Las Vegas specializes in Southeast Asian and Cantonese cuisines. Known for its casual yet vibrant atmosphere, this restaurant serves everything from gourmet wok-fried dishes to Hong Kong-style barbecue. The Dim Sum menu is particularly noteworthy, offering a range of meticulously prepared, bite-sized delights.

Chengdu Taste

For those who crave the bold, spicy flavors of Szechuan cuisine, Chengdu Taste is a must-visit. It’s famous for its mouth-numbing Szechuan peppercorns that are a staple in dishes like Toothpick Lamb and Boiled Fish in Green Pepper Sauce. The authenticity and intensity of flavors here make for an adventurous and unforgettable dining experience.

Jasmine – Bellagio Hotel & Casino

Jasmine at Bellagio Hotel & Casino is not only renowned for its sumptuous Cantonese cuisine but also for its stunning views of the Bellagio fountains. This elegant restaurant offers a mix of traditional Chinese dishes with a modern twist, set against a backdrop of opulent décor reminiscent of French provincial interiors. The Peking Duck and Dim Sum assortments are some of the highlights, combining refined tastes with a luxurious dining environment.

Mott 32 – The Venetian Resort

Mott 32, located in The Venetian Resort, is known for its unique blend of Cantonese, Beijing, and Szechuan cuisines. This upscale dining spot prides itself on its farm-to-table approach, with signature dishes like the Apple Wood Roasted Peking Duck and Barbecue Pluma Iberico Pork. The stylish, contemporary decor with Chinese cultural motifs creates an immersive dining experience that’s both visually and gastronomically stunning.

Mr. Chow – Caesars Palace

Mr. Chow, housed in the iconic Caesars Palace, offers a luxurious interpretation of Beijing cuisine alongside artistic ambiance and exceptional service. Known for its famous Beijing Duck, Green Prawns, and hand-pulled Mr. Chow Noodles, the restaurant’s theatrical design and live cooking stations add to the exclusivity and flair of the dining experience.

Joyful House Chinese Cuisine

For those venturing off the Strip, Joyful House Chinese Cuisine offers an extensive selection of authentic Cantonese dishes. This spacious and simply decorated restaurant is popular among locals for its live seafood tanks, ensuring the freshest catch. From classic dim sum to delectable seafood and roast meats, the menu provides an array of options catering to all tastes.

China Poblano – The Cosmopolitan of Las Vegas

China Poblano creatively combines Chinese and Mexican cuisines, delivering a fusion unlike any other. Chef José Andrés’ innovative menu includes items like Dan Dan Noodles and Tacos with a twist, making it a unique culinary destination. The vibrant and eclectic atmosphere matches the menu’s inventiveness, perfect for adventurous diners.

China House – Palms Casino Resort

The China House at Palms Casino Resort, led by celebrity chef Tony Hu, is renowned for its authentic Szechuan cuisine and commitment to bold, spicy flavors. This restaurant serves a variety of traditional dishes like Ma Po Tofu and Szechuan Dried Chili Chicken. The contemporary decor and attentive service make it a comfortable spot for those looking to explore the depths of Szechuan peppercorn-infused dishes.
